Lionel Messi's wages at Inter Miami in numbers Lionel Messi earns $393,205 (£302,772) under his current contract at Inter Miami. His annual guaranteed compensation scales up to $20.4m million (£15.7m), which makes him the highest earner at the club, way ahead of everyone else.
Messi will make $20,446,667 in guaranteed compensation this year, with a base salary of $12 million in his first full season with Inter Miami.

Messi's Miami, the league's regular-season Supporters Shield champion, led the league with a record $41.7m payroll, double all but Toronto ($31.8m), Los Angeles FC ($22.1m), the LA Galaxy ($22m) and Nashville ($21.9m).
